🫧

Elastomer degradation and microparticle shedding

Long-term elastomer wear under sweat, friction, and UV exposure may produce microscopic particles; no specific data on Fitbit Air shedding, but any elastomer product can degrade over 2-3 years of daily wear. Risk is low for skin contact but non-zero for ingestion if particles are transferred via hands to mouth.

70/ 100
⚠️

Bacterial colonization of band seams and crevices

Elastomer bands trap moisture and dead skin in seams and underside if not cleaned regularly. This is a hygiene issue (dermatitis, folliculitis) rather than chemical toxicity but relevant to product use. Fitbit does not document antimicrobial treatment of the Air band.

70/ 100
⚠️

Allergic sensitization to elastomer additives

Some elastomers contain accelerators, stabilizers, or colorants (e.g., sulfur compounds, zinc oxide, carbon black) that rarely trigger contact dermatitis or urticaria in sensitive users. Google does not disclose the elastomer formulation. Risk is low but non-zero for prolonged skin contact.

The full breakdown

What it's made of and why it matters

The Fitbit Air uses an elastomer band, a synthetic rubber polymer that resists sweat, moisture, and daily wear without the coating degradation risks of painted or enameled metal. Elastomers are chemically inert under normal skin contact and do not leach heavy metals like cadmium or lead. The screenless design means no glass lens adhesives or display materials that could off-gas or degrade. This is a relatively simple material profile for a wearable.

The brand's record and disclosure

Google does not publish detailed material safety data sheets or PFAS statements for most Fitbit products, which is common practice in the wearables industry but limits transparency. Fitbit has faced no major recalls or documented toxicity complaints in the fitness tracker category. Google's broader product safety stance includes compliance certifications but rarely extends to detailed chemical disclosure for accessories like bands.

How it compares in its category

Elastomer bands are the category standard for waterproof wearables and show lower concern for corrosion and leaching compared to metal bands, which can corrode and leach, silicone variants which may contain trace additives, or cloth straps which can harbor bacteria if not cleaned. Screenless devices avoid the adhesive and coating hazards present in display-heavy trackers. The Fitbit Air sits in the low-complexity, low-hazard end of the fitness tracker spectrum.

If you buy it

Rinse the elastomer band regularly with fresh water after sweating or swimming to prevent salt and chlorine buildup, which can degrade the material over time. Avoid prolonged exposure to direct sunlight or heat above 50C (122F) to minimize elastomer brittleness. Replace the band if visible cracking, discoloration, or softening occurs. The lack of a replaceable battery in screenless trackers means the device itself will eventually require recycling, but the band can be disposed with rubber waste.
